@bahmanm@lemmy.ml
@bahmanm@lemmy.ml avatar

bahmanm

@bahmanm@lemmy.ml

Husband, father, kabab lover, history buff, chess fan and software engineer. Believes creating software must resemble art: intuitive creation and joyful discovery.

šŸŒŽ linktr.ee/bahmanm

Views are my own.

This profile is from a federated server and may be incomplete. Browse more on the original instance.

bahmanm,
@bahmanm@lemmy.ml avatar

When i read the title, my immediate thought was ā€œMojolicious project renamed? To a name w/ an emoji!?ā€ šŸ˜‚


We plan to open-source Mojo progressively over time

Yea, right! I canā€™t believe that there are people who prefer to work on/with a closed source programming language in 2023 (as if itā€™s the 80ā€™s.)

ā€¦ can move faster than a community effort, so we will continue to incubate it within Modular until itā€™s more complete.

Apparently it was ā€œcompleteā€ enough to ask the same ā€œcommunityā€ for feedback.

I genuinely wonder how they managed to convince enthusiasts to give them free feedback/testing (on github/discord) for something they didnā€™t have access to the source code.


PS: I didnā€™t downvote. I simply got upset to see this happening in 2023.

bahmanm,
@bahmanm@lemmy.ml avatar

Feedack from Emacs Matrix room:

The code will fail if a sequence contains duplicates
Also, seq-* implies that it is assuming to work on any sequence type, not just lists

bahmanm,
@bahmanm@lemmy.ml avatar

Thanks. Yes, lemmy-status.org was where I got the initial idea šŸ’Æ

automatic list

For the website Iā€™m thinking about, Iā€™d rather keep it exclusively opt-in. I donā€™t wish to add any extra load since most of the instances are running off of enthusiastsā€™ pockets.

bahmanm,
@bahmanm@lemmy.ml avatar

I still havenā€™t made up my mind as to what is a good interval. But I think Iā€™ll take a per-endpoint approach, hitting more expensive ones less frequently.

So far I can only think of 4-5 endpoints/URLs that I should hit in every iteration as outlined in the post above.

web/mobile home feed
web/mobile create post/comment
web/mobile search

I think those will cover most of the usecases.

bahmanm,
@bahmanm@lemmy.ml avatar

Thanks all for the input šŸ™

I did a quick experiment w/ the APIs and I think I have identified the ones Iā€™d need. Obviously, all is open source (GPLv3) available on github: lemmy-clerk

As the next step, Iā€™m going to expose that data to Prometheus for scraping.

bahmanm,
@bahmanm@lemmy.ml avatar

Thatā€™s a fair use-case.

You see memes in your feed (despite not subscribing to memeā€™y communities). Three things come to my mind, thinking out loud here:

(1) Could it be b/c the community is not granular enough? Remember weā€™re in the early stages of Lemmy w/ big ā€œholisticā€ communities. Iā€™d suppose as we grow, a overarching community will specialise and be split into several more specific ones?

(2) Creating ā€œfiltersā€ based on tag/content is a fair usecase and I would second the idea as long as the main dimension of organisation remains ā€œcommunity.ā€ Iā€™m a bit over-attached to ā€œcommunityā€ b/c I feel thatā€™s a defining element of Lemmy experience & am afraid that touching that balance may change the essence.

(3) Tags can be used to achieve (2) indeed but is the added complexity (ā“) to the codebase and UI/UX worth it?

bahmanm,
@bahmanm@lemmy.ml avatar

OK, I think I see your point more clearly now. I suppose thatā€™s what many others do (apparently I donā€™t represent the norm ever šŸ˜‚.)

So tags can be useful for not only listening but also discovery.

I guess my concern RE tag & community competing. But Iā€™ve got no prior experience designing a social/community based application to be confident to take my case to the RFC.

Hopefully time will prove me wrong.

bahmanm,
@bahmanm@lemmy.ml avatar

a list or database of projects that were open but then closed down

Thatā€™s a great idea! Esp if the list is actively maintained & updated.

Since I am NOT the author of this extension, do you think you could write down your thoughts on the projectā€™s issue tracker?

bahmanm,
@bahmanm@lemmy.ml avatar

Thatā€™s a fair point šŸ‘ I just wanted to point out that Iā€™m not the author.

As I said, I very much like the idea. It helps raise awareness around the current trend of switching licenses to curb competition/make $$$.

bahmanm,
@bahmanm@lemmy.ml avatar

I articulated my thoughts on the topic in a separate post: [DISCUSS] Website to monitor Lemmy serversā€™ performance/availability

Please share your thoughts/feedback over there.

  • All
  • Subscribed
  • Moderated
  • Favorites
  • ā€¢
  • JUstTest
  • cubers
  • DreamBathrooms
  • ngwrru68w68
  • Durango
  • osvaldo12
  • magazineikmin
  • mdbf
  • Youngstown
  • slotface
  • rosin
  • everett
  • kavyap
  • anitta
  • normalnudes
  • thenastyranch
  • khanakhh
  • cisconetworking
  • modclub
  • GTA5RPClips
  • InstantRegret
  • tacticalgear
  • provamag3
  • ethstaker
  • tester
  • Leos
  • megavids
  • lostlight
  • All magazines